So it is essential to determine … WebJun 1, 1991 · Specific gravity is the weight of the cement divided by the weight of an equal volume of water. If you're using portland cement, 1 cubic foot loose volume weights 94 pounds and has a specific gravity of 3.15. Dividing the weight, 94 pounds, by the specific gravity times the unit weight of water (62.4 pounds per cubic foot) gives a volume of ...

WebJun 11, 2024 · The specific gravity of cement can be defined as the ratio of the density or the mass of cement to the density or the mass of reference material. Specific gravity is an important indicator that defines how much heavier a substance is than water or any reference material of the same volume.

Density is the mass per unit volume of a material. Specific gravity is a measure of the ratio of mass of a given volume of material at 23°C to the same volume of deionized water.
